How they compare

Czechia currently reports 25.75 kg/ha against 25.12 kg/ha in Indonesia, a difference of 0.63 kg/ha.

Across all 31 years both countries report, Czechia has been ahead every year.

Czechia ranks 83rd and Indonesia ranks 85th of 200 countries.

Czechia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Czechia Indonesia Difference Ahead
1990s 34.17 kg/ha 13.54 kg/ha 20.63 kg/ha Czechia
2000s 30.51 kg/ha 13.19 kg/ha 17.32 kg/ha Czechia
2010s 27.28 kg/ha 18.94 kg/ha 8.34 kg/ha Czechia
2020s 25.53 kg/ha 24.11 kg/ha 1.42 kg/ha Czechia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
